Xi Jinping in Saudi Arabia.

During his three day visit to Saudi Arabia, Xi attended summits of the six-member Gulf Co-operation Council and a broader China-Arab leaders' meeting.

It came a day after bilateral talks with Saudi royals and yielded a joint statement harping on "the importance of stability" in oil markets - a point of friction with the United States. Washington has urged the Saudis to raise production.

"China will continue to firmly support the GCC countries in maintaining their own security and build a collective security framework for the Gulf".

China will import large quantities of crude oil from GCC countries on an ongoing basis. It also promises to expand other areas of energy co-operation including liquefied natural gas imports. Oil from Saudi Arabia alone accounted for 17% of China's imports last year and last month Qatar announced a 27-year natural gas deal with China.

Both sides are seeking economic and strategic benefits by deepening co-operation.
